60-year-old man, 3 others rape 9-year-old girl

By Jennifer Y Omiloli

Sixty-year-old man Usman Ibrahim and three others have been arrested for allegedly defiling a 9-year-old girl in Niger state’s Paikoro Local Government Area.

Usman, a man with five grandchildren, and the other suspects, Zakari Aliyu, 25; Mustapha Isah, 17; and Imurana Aliyu, I6, were arrested by a group of police officers attached to the Paiko Division.

This was confirmed by the spokesperson of the command, Muhammad Abubakar, in a statement, Abubakar said the perpetrators usually lured the victim with N20 or N50 and then rape her.

They were charged after the victim’s mother spotted one of the suspects in the act and the police arrested him.

The victim told her mother about the other men who also raped her after giving her N20 or N50 when she was interrogated.

The spokesperson for the police said the suspects will be arraigned in court once the investigations are completed.
